• 6280阅读
  • 8回复

示例工程转换VS2015后无法正常运行的问题 [复制链接]

上一主题 下一主题
离线mmcer
 

只看楼主 倒序阅读 使用道具 楼主  发表于: 2015-12-18
我这边下载的官方 Aplayer 的示例,貌似是用vs 2005开发的。我这边的环境是使用的 Win10 64位 + VS 2015,经过转换后发现不能编译。
  
比较了一下,发现 simpleplayer.cpp 代码里引用的是 atl.lib ,事实上VC 2015的目录下已经没有这个库了,就只剩下 atls.lib 库,修改引用这个库,并且添加了#include <atlhost.h>头文件。
  
再次编译可以成功,但是运行崩溃。崩溃在 atlcom.h 文件,错误提示为



请教下现在这个问题要如何处理?
laodaoxia.com
离线mmcer

只看该作者 沙发  发表于: 2015-12-18
有人可以分享下经过VS2015转换后可以正常运行的示例工程么?
laodaoxia.com
离线mmcer

只看该作者 板凳  发表于: 2015-12-18
管理员快出来呀。
本帖提到的人: @aplayer
laodaoxia.com
离线落寞的鱼

只看该作者 地板  发表于: 2015-12-19
从低版本系统中获取一个ATL.dll文件到运行目录即可
落寞的鱼
离线mmcer

只看该作者 4楼 发表于: 2015-12-20
回 落寞的鱼 的帖子
落寞的鱼:从低版本系统中获取一个ATL.dll文件到运行目录即可 (2015-12-19 08:55) 

我这边拷贝了一个低版本的dll到运行目录还是失败了。
laodaoxia.com
离线mmcer

只看该作者 5楼 发表于: 2015-12-24
平安夜,好多妹子本来是准备吃苹果的,结果最后吃了香蕉,还喝了豆浆。好在这个问题终于被解决了。
laodaoxia.com
离线lihui115

只看该作者 6楼 发表于: 2015-12-26
回 mmcer 的帖子
mmcer:平安夜,好多妹子本来是准备吃苹果的,结果最后吃了香蕉,还喝了豆浆。好在这个问题终于被解决了。 (2015-12-24 21:37) 

请问下怎么解决的,我2013也有这个问题
离线蚊小子

只看该作者 7楼 发表于: 2016-11-19
这个怎么解决的?
离线paul

只看该作者 8楼 发表于: 2017-01-19
这个怎么解决的?
快速回复
限100 字节
如果您提交过一次失败了,可以用”恢复数据”来恢复帖子内容
 
上一个 下一个